"textContent": "The fibre mat manufacturing process uses first (4) and second cavities with the same shaped matrix base (7) but with the volume of the second cavity being less than that of the first and with its shape corresponding to the completed mat shape. The first cavity, formed between the matrix and a first set of dies (3), is filled by suction with a fibre mixture to give it an initial shape, and the fibres are then partially thermally bonded to hold them together while the second cavity is formed between the same matrix and a second set of dies. The thermal bonding is then completed, with the fibre mat in its final shape. The second stage can include attaching a covering layer of a dense material with an acoustic absorption porosity.",
